About the Role
As a residential carpenter with us, you will be part of a dynamic team engaged in a mix of new builds and high-end residential renovations. Your contributions will help create functional, safe, and visually appealing homes. A solid understanding of timber construction techniques and concrete formwork will be essential in this position.
Key Responsibilities
- Perform framing, cladding, and finishing carpentry
- Read and interpret construction plans and specifications
- Work with both timber and concrete materials
- Adhere to NZ Building Code standards
- Maintain high health and safety standards in line with WorkSafe NZ
- Collaborate with other trades and site managers to meet project milestones
